(Uniondale, NY & Garden City, NY May 8, 2025)
The New York Dragons have reached an agreement with Nassau Community College to have all 2025 home and away games broadcast on WHPC 90.3 FM, the school’s on-campus radio station. WHPC will be the official home for all Dragons regular season and playoff games along with a weekly half-hour Dragons radio show.
“We’re excited to have our games broadcast on WHPC this season,” said New York Dragons General Manager Peter Schwartz. “This is a partnership that delivers for everyone involved including our fans, our organization and the Nassau Community College community. My college radio experience helped me launch my career in sports, so I’m thrilled to be working with WHPC on these broadcasts and to help mentor future professional broadcasters and producers.”
In addition to the 90.3 FM signal, WHPC streams on-line at www.NCCradio.org as well as the WHPC, Audacy, iHeartRadio and Tunein apps, and is available by asking smart speakers to “Play WHPC.” The Dragons broadcasts and weekly Dragons show will be produced by WHPC student broadcasters who will also serve as the on-air talent for play-by-play, analyst and sideline reporter.
“I am so excited to be bringing the inaugural season of the return of Arena Football and the New York Dragons to the airwaves exclusively on WHPC,” said Shawn Novatt, WHPC’s Faculty Director. “Thank you to General Manager Peter Schwartz for trusting our educational mission and giving this amazing opportunity to the students at Nassau Community College. Go Dragons!”
The Dragons will open their first ENTFLA season, at home, on Saturday June 14th against the New Jersey Ciphers at Nassau Coliseum.

About WHPC
WHPC 90.3 FM broadcasts from state-of-the-art studios at Nassau Community College,
a campus of the State University of New York, in Garden City, New York. Listener-supported
non-commercial WHPC has served Nassau County for over 50 years with award-winning
programming. WHPC is the educational training center for future broadcasters, podcasters
and communication professionals. WHPC streams its student and community programs and
podcasts nationally on the WHPC, Audacy, iHeartRadio and Spotify apps. Learn more
about WHPC by visiting www.NCCradio.org.
About Nassau Community College
Nassau Community College, a campus of the State University of New York, provides a
comprehensive public college experience designed to prepare students to start, and
continue, their successful journey through higher education. Serving over 17,000 full-time
and part-time students annually, NCC offers over 70 associate degree programs and
25 certificate programs. Through on-campus and online offerings, the College educates
local and international students and boasts over 163,000 alumni. Situated on 225 acres
in Garden City, Long Island, the college grounds reside in historic Nassau County,
one of the most desirable locations to live in the United States and an epicenter
for business and careers. Since 1959, NCC has earned a nationwide reputation for academic
excellence and ease of transferability to four-year schools.
